UPDATE: One Dead, Seven Injured in Vegas Tesla Explosion, Now TERROR Investigation

A Tesla Cybertruck exploded and caught fire outside the Trump Towers in Las Vegas, according to officials and video showing the vehicle engulfed in flames. A person inside the vehicle died and there seven others suffered minor injuries, police said.

"There is one deceased individual in the Cybertruck, and I don't know whether it's a male or female," said Sheriff Kevin McMahill of the Las Vegas Metropolitan Police Department at a press conference.

He added, "At this time, we are investigating a number of leads, and I'm not prepared to release any of that information to you just yet. We can. I can tell you that there are seven victims right now that sustained injuries from the explosion." He said those injuries are reportedly minor.

BREAKING: Authorities are investigating a Tesla Cybertruck explosion outside the Trump Las Vegas hotel in Nevada as a possible act of terror.
